Why Melatonin & Other Non-Prescription Options May Benefit You
Melatonin is a hormone naturally produced by the body to regulate the sleep-wake cycle (circadian rhythm).
Taking a supplemental form may be beneficial for temporarily adjusting your internal clock. This is particularly helpful for conditions such as jet lag, delayed sleep phase disorder (difficulty falling asleep at a conventional time), or temporary shift work disorder.
Other non-prescription options, like L-Theanine or Glycine, are sometimes used to promote relaxation and improve sleep quality without the strong sedative effects of prescription drugs. When used correctly and for the right duration, these options offer a gentle way to address transient sleep difficulties, providing relief with generally fewer side effects than traditional sleep medication.

Knowing When to Explore Melatonin & Other Non-Prescription Options
Melatonin and similar non-prescription aids are generally intended for short-term use or specific circadian rhythm issues, not chronic insomnia.
It is appropriate to explore these options after you have first maximized good sleep hygiene practices (like maintaining a cool, dark room and a consistent bedtime). A virtual consultation is warranted if your sleep issues are related to:
- Circadian Disruption: Symptoms due to recent air travel across time zones (jet lag).
- Initial Sleep Onset: Difficulty falling asleep, but you generally stay asleep once rested.
- Temporary Stress: Short bouts of insomnia lasting less than two weeks due to acute stress.
- Transitioning Off Medication: When looking for a gentler aid after discontinuing prescription sleep medications.
If your sleep issues persist beyond two weeks, it is crucial to book a TelMDCare appointment to rule out or manage underlying conditions like anxiety, depression, or sleep apnea.

If my sleep problem is chronic, will Melatonin still be the right choice?
Melatonin is generally intended for short-term use or specific circadian issues (like jet lag). If your sleep problem is chronic (lasting more than a few weeks), your doctor will use the consultation to explore all options, including behavioral therapy or prescription medications, as Melatonin alone may not be sufficient.
